Originally, a notebook was a small booklet used to record various matters. Before the invention of writing, humans often used the method of tying knots in ropes to record numbers or events, expressing certain meanings to convey information. From the remains of paintings in primitive society, such as reticulated patterns, rope patterns on pottery, and pottery net pendants, it can be seen that knot-tying to record events (counting) was one of the widely used recording methods by primitive ancestors.

Notebooks come in various types, with cover materials commonly including genuine leather, imitation leather PU, leather, PP, fabric, and metal. Binding methods include: paperback notebooks, loose-leaf notebooks, ring-bound notebooks, and hardcover notebooks.
